Browse Source

incoming orders parsing improvement

Dev Server 1 year ago
parent
commit
8eca63414c
2 changed files with 5 additions and 4 deletions
  1. 2 2
      jsonAndRequest.py
  2. 3 2
      open_template_bot.py

+ 2 - 2
jsonAndRequest.py

@@ -227,8 +227,8 @@ def requestGetListUser():
     print(response.json())
 
 
-def requestGetList(token, url):
-    auth_token=requestGetToken("", "", "")
+def requestGetList(login, password, url):
+    auth_token=requestGetToken(login, password, url)
     #print(auth_token)
     headers = {'Authorization': f'Token {auth_token}'}
     #url = 'https://user.sharix-app.org/platform/api/sharix-users/'

+ 3 - 2
open_template_bot.py

@@ -62,7 +62,7 @@ def message_handler(conn, mess):
         print(mess)
 
         if text is not None:
-            orderObj = jsreq.jsonToClass(text)
+            orderObj = jsreq.jsonToOrderTicket(text)
             print (orderObj)
             tasklist.append(orderObj)
             process_status.append(0)
@@ -133,7 +133,8 @@ tasklist = []
 
 #надо инициализировать tasklist при запуске из API
 token = requestGetToken(botname, PASSWORD, API_URL+"/auth/token/login/")
-requestGetList(token, API_URL+"/tickets/api/tickets")
+#requestGetList(token, API_URL+"/tickets/api/tickets")
+requestGetList(botname, password, API_URL+"/tickets/api/tickets")
 #надо дописать таким образом, чтобы tasklist пополнялся тикетами определенного листа, а не всех